WebWilliam Dean Wickline Jr. (March 15, 1952 March 30, 2004), known as The Butcher, was an American career criminal and later serial killer linked to at least three violent murders committed in West Virginia and Ohio from 1979 to 1982. Wrongfully convicted people in West Virginia cant sue the state for compensation because courts and judges have broad immunity from lawsuits.
